Biography

John Otten teaches computer ethics and society at the College of Engineering and Computing. In addition to instructing undergraduates in the important considerations surrounding legal, social, and ethical issues surrounding software development and computer use, Otten’s research interests include computer science education, parallel and distributed systems, large-scale and embedded systems, automotive networks, computer applications in music, global system for mobile and cellular technology, software optimization.
